Biography

The Sentinel Purge is a time that will forever be remembered by both the dying world and the annals of history. While many heroes died during the third world war, there were a handful that remained, struggling until the very end to defend the frightened citizens from annihilation. One of these heroes known only as “Hax” spent the last days of his life evacuating and protecting civilians targeted by the sentinels. In the end the hero saved many lives but died at the hands of the sentinels. However, while the hero is remembered as a good man that gave his all, mega corporations such as AIM saw an even greater potential.

Having a natural intuition and applied education in machines and magic, the hero Hax had spent time trying to develop a way to control sentinels or even re-create sentinels that would serve as a first and last line of defense. Unfortunately, the hero had neither the time nor resources to properly develop this idea, but AIM knew that his knowledge and natural aptitude with technology would be a great asset if they were to try developing sentinels of their own. Since the discovery of the genetic arks, AIM like most mega corporations staked ownership on as many arks as possible with the overall idea of recreating the best of the best to serve in their ranks. In one the arks AIM hit one of their jackpots; a genetic profile of the Hax individual, but with one problem. The template for the Hax profile was incomplete and thus incredibly difficult to successfully clone, but with vast resources AIM had only to wait until their cloning processes yielded a success.

Decades later, AIM had yet to clone a profile that was within their ideal percentiles of the original Hax, but AIM had managed to clone with creative splicing and virtual reality simulators a handful of individuals similar to the Hax profile. While these individuals do not possess the exact memories of the original (AIM’s research on the Hax individual is only so complete) they do have the same aptitude for technology and magic. Picking the best and brightest from their batches, AIM placed three in charge of various research projects related to sentinels while the rest were returned to the cloning research facilities to better replicate their success. As one of the only presumably alive clones, 40-4 was in charge of the project team researching how the sentinels were made in order to replicate their creation. While simply a tool for AIM, because each of their successful clones were precious, 40-4 was given every accommodation as well as access to AIM’s best resources in order to further their goals. For a scientist 40-4 lived like a king. So why did he choose to go AWOL?

For someone who cared very little for human company 40-4 made an unlikely accomplice. Test Subject 5 for the AIDOS project who had been cloned to pilot the reacquired AIDOS suit had been along with 40-4 deemed a waste of resources and AIM would be phasing both projects out for good. This generally means an abrupt and mortally inconvenient “early retirement” for all non-essential or dangerous personnel involved with these projects. In light of this news 40-4 was very concerned. Afterall, he was planning on leaving anyway with his research coming to a dead end without at least an actual piece of sentinel tech, something that not even AIM’s vast resources could procure for 40-4. The news simply made the choice to leave easier, and with Subject 5 already planning an escape of his own 40-4 made a deal that would help both men escape to pursue their own interests.

After escaping the AIM facility, both 40-4 and Subject 5 kept travelling together as partners in crime with Subject 5 “repoing” technology from various “clients” and 40-4 maintaining and modifying the technology for black markets. With a steady cash flow 40-4 is able to keep a supply of his medication as well as fund his efforts to finally obtain or locate a sentinel and continue his research.

Themesong

Aspects

High Concept:

Reality Hacking Inventor

40-4 is a mutant who bends reality to his will by using a sophisticated form of rune magic to create spells. Unlike most forms of rune magic, 40-4 is able to "code" a spell in a special magical computer that appears over his forearm allowing him to create spells on the fly.

Trouble:

"Come Back We Need You!"

Since his departure from AIM (he did put in his two weeks, albeit encrypted in a dead language), 40-4 has become good at dodging his desperate, former employer or really anyone who wants to find him. AIM spent countless resources both creating 40-4 and supporting his research. So, to say AIM is scouring the earth for 40-4 is an understatement as he is both an invaluable asset and important key to furthering their sentinel research.

Trapper

One of the few activities 40-4 takes great pleasure in are practical pranks. Since he left the test tube, 40-4 has be known by AIM operatives to be a notorious prankster creating more sophisticated ways and complex spells to get a cheap laugh at his associates' expense. When it came time to leave AIM, 40-4 utilized his vast experience to makes his "pranks" significantly more lethal.

Deaf As a Doorknob

Defects in clones from the Hax profile are common. For 40-4 one of his defects is being unable to hear. To compensate for his inability, 40-4 learned to communicate and interact with the world in various ways such as reading lips, using his magic to speak for him, or even paying more attention to vibrations in his surroundings.

Sentinel Expert

40-4 has devoted all of his waking life to researching the Sentinel Project, more specifically how the sentinels themselves may have been made. While he certainly doesn't have any concrete answers on how to replicate sentinels, 40-4 does have extensive knowledge on the history of the project as well as multiple working theories about sentinel manufacturing; all thanks to the morally bankrupt curiosity of AIM and their vast network of resources.

Stunts

Surgical Strikes

Description: As 40-4 has perfected his craft, so has his ability to selectively target a single person from a crowd for his mostly harmless "pranks".

Mechanical Effect: When using Crafts in a conflict involving machinery, you can filter out unwanted targets from whole-zone attacks without having to divide up your shifts (normally, you’d need to divide your roll between your targets).

Stunt Cost: 1

Power Suite One: The Reality Gauntlet

Subject 40-4 wields a variant of the magic used by the original "Hax" individual. Willing a hard-light-like projection around his left arm, 40-4 can perform impossible feats by using a magic-tech hybrid in the form of runes that lay along the gauntlet. The end result is a power that lets 40-4 hack reality in order to achieve the outcome he desires. Like a blast of spontaneous energy to the guy's face. Or that guy. Yeah, that guy right there. He's going to fall into a trap that creates a sudden, unexpected pit-fall. When reality can be re-written and the tools at your fingertips, 40-4 can certainly overcome most odds.

Power Breakdown

  • Energy Blast - Make Shoot attacks with a range of up to 3 zones.
    • Gadgeteering - +2 Crafts to build or repair complex devices. Know the general function of a machine just by looking at it.
      • Master Gadgeteering - +2 Crafts when repairing or building complex devices.
    • Shielding - Create a barrier between zones. Attacks through it are defended with your Will. Successful attacks do mental stress to you or shatter the barrier and do half mental stress. Each barrier after the first gives you a Will penalty of -1.
      • Precision Shielding - You may shield a specific human sized target instead of a whole zone.
      • Opaque Shields - Your shields may be transparent, opaque or anything in between.
    • Theme: Chaos Conduit (Mutant Only) - Your powers are accompanied by manifestations of chaos such as lights, minor fortean phenomena and similar.
      • Realm Warp - Create advantages on the scene using Will to represent reality manipulations. Aspects like 'No Gravity' in a small area have Fair (+2) opposition. Larger or more complex effects have higher opposition.
